Co-cultivation of a nitrogen-fixing strain of Azomonas macrocytogenes and an antagonist strain of Bacillus atrophaeus

The possibility of co-cultivation of the nitrogen-fixing strain Azomonas macrocytogenes OSV-2 and the antagonist strain of phytopathogenic fungi Bacillus atrophaeus B-13893 for the purpose of using it in a complex biological preparation with nitrogen-fixing and antimycotic activity was studied. Both strains were isolated by the authors from agricultural soils and identified by the nucleotide sequence of the 16S rRNA gene. It has been established that the strains do not show mutual antagonism and grow well in a joint culture on an artificial nutrient medium. When measuring microcolonies, no statistically significant growth inhibition of the nitrogen-fixing strain A. macrocytogenes OSV-2 was found in the presence of the antagonist strain B. atrophaeus B-13893. Thus, both strains can be used together to improve the nitrogen nutrition of plants and the biological protection of plants from fungal diseases.
